SAMANIDS of PERSIA, Nuh ibn Nasr. aka Nuh II (b. Nasr), 331-343 AH(943-954). AR Dirhem (2.96 gm; 28 mm). obverse at the top phrase either "Ali" or "Maki" (per Tabatabai/Wathiq) followed by phrase "Zafar" (Victory), reverse, Name of deposed Abbasid Khalif Al-Mustakfi followed by king's name Nuh ibn Nasr, mint Nishabur, year 341 AH.
